Mumbai:  In its bid to improve conviction rate in cases related to crime against women, Maharashtra Director General of Police Pravin Dixit Wednesday issued directives that
chargesheet in molestation cases be filed in courts within 24 hours.

Dixit, told PTI, directives have been given to ensure that
as far as possible chargesheet in molestation cases be filed
within 24 hours.


"This will hopefully lead to improving conviction rate
in cases related to crime against women," he said.


He said all Units in-charge are sensitizing the officials
and staff regarding registration of molestation cases and
filing of chargesheet.
